    Demand for shipping companies has fallen sharply due to low occupancy rates, and the container rental market has declined and accelerated in the past week in the off-season of summer.
     
     
     
    The current demand of shipping companies is very weak, especially in Europe and the Caribbean. According to brokers, most of the deals came from the Asian market. In Asia, 1000 TEU - 2000 TEU ships are the most popular.
     
     
     
    Several charter indices continued to fall. Among them, the Boxi index released by Braemar seascope this week fell 1.95 points to 94.65. The Hamburg Brokers Association's new contex index fell to 641 from 655 a week ago. The new contex index, which is released twice a week, has fallen for 12 consecutive release days.
     
     
     
    Most transactions in the market are subleases. Mediterranean Shipping confirmed that it has rented three 6500 TEU ships from Hanjin office, with a rental of US $30000 / day and a lease term of 8 months. In addition, they rented the APL Sydney (built in 2006, 3530 TEU) for a six-month term of $15000 / day.
     
     
     
    It is said that simatech rented "Tatiana Schulte" (built in 2005, 2820teu), with a lease term of 8-10 months and a rent of 14000 USD / day. This transaction is also sublease. In terms of super Panamax container ships, mediterranean shipping is still the most active charterer. They rented two 5060 TEU ships "MSc Debra" and "MSc Mara" built in 2006, each of which costs US $25000 / day and has a 12-month lease term.
     
     
     
    The large number of ships available for sublease in the market continues to put downward pressure on the Charter price. It is said that seacastle's 12-month rental for a 5100 TEU is only $18000 / day, far below the price in the previous comparable transaction. The price also surprised brokers, because not long ago the same size but older ships sold for more than that.
     
     
     
    Overall, the biggest drop was in the rents of large ships. According to the Hamburg Brokers Association, the 2700 TEU has the largest decline. Smaller ships such as the 1700 TEU have shown better flexibility, even though rents have fallen about $1000 from a few weeks ago.
     
     
     
    The increasing uncertainty in the market has once again raised the issue of idle and redundant ships, but according to brokers, no owners have yet taken such measures.
     
     
     
    A small number of shipping companies with chartering interests are clearly in the upper hand in negotiations with shipowners. They are not in a hurry to finalize the contract now. In this way, renters usually get lower rents and more favorable terms. Last week, the reappearance of flexible terms in the market was the result of the tenant strategy.
     
     
     
    In addition, the general bearish attitude of Charterers also benefits the shipping companies. Confidence that rents will return sharply later this year is fading.
